The Italian
order of precedence is fixed partly by Royal Decree no. 2210 ofDecember 16 ,1927 and partly by the praxis. It's a hierarchy of officials in the Italian Republic used to direct protocol.#The President of the Republic (
Giorgio Napolitano )
#The President of the Senate of the Republic (Renato Schifani )
#The President of the Chamber of Deputies (Gianfranco Fini )
#The President of the Council of Ministers (Silvio Berlusconi )
#The President of the Constitutional Court (Franco Bile )
#Former Presidents of the Republic, in order of appointment (Francesco Cossiga ,Oscar Luigi Scalfaro ,Carlo Azeglio Ciampi )
#Vice Presidents of the Senate of the Republic
#Vice Presidents of the Chamber of Deputies
#The Vice President of the Council of Ministers
#The Vice President of the Constitutional Court (Giovanni Maria Flick )
#Ministers of the Republic
#Justices of the Constitutional Court
#The Vice President of theConsiglio Superiore della Magistratura ( body of selfgoverment of the judicial system, its president 'de jure' being the President of the Republic ) (Nicola Mancino )
#The President of the National Council of Economy and Labour (Antonio Marzano )
#Deputy Ministers of the Republic
#"Questori" Senators and Deputies, in order of seniority
#Presidents of Parliamentary Commissions
#Presidents of "Giunte Regionali", or Governors of Regions
#The First President of the Supreme Court of Cassation (Nicola Marvulli )
#The President of the Council of State
#The President of the Court of Accounts
#The Governor of the Central Bank of Italy (Mario Draghi )
#The General Prosecutor of the Cassazione (Mario Delli Priscoli )
#TheAttorney General of the Republic (Oscar Fiumara )
#TheChief of the Defence Staff (Adm.Giampaolo di Paola )
#Senators and Deputies, in order of appointment
#The President of theAccademia dei Lincei (Giovanni Conso )
#The President of the National Research Council (Fabio Pistella )
#The President of the Supreme Tribunal of the Waters
#The Vice President of the Council of Military Courts
#The Vice President of the High Council of Courts
#The Presidents of the Autonomous Provinces of Trento and Bolzano-Bozen
#The Deputy President of the Supreme Court of Cassation
#Mayor s, in their cities
#Prefect s, in their cities
#Presidents and General Prosecutors of theCourt of Appeals
#Presidents of Provinces, in their cities
#The Chief of the Army Staff (Gen.Filiberto Cecchi )
#The Chief of the Navy Staff (Adm.Paolo La Rosa )
#The Chief of the Air Staff (Gen.Vincenzo Camporini )
#The President of the Permanent conference ofRector s
#Ambassadors, in order of establishment of diplomatic relations with their countries*
